コード例 #1
0
 public override void WriteValue(string type, object value)
 {
     try
     {
         G.writeObject(value);
     }
     catch (IOException e)
     {
         throw new WebApplicationException(e);
     }
 }
コード例 #2
0
 protected internal override string SerializeValue(string type, object value)
 {
     try
     {
         G.writeObject(value);
         return(null);
     }
     catch (IOException e)
     {
         throw new WebApplicationException(e);
     }
 }
コード例 #3
0
//JAVA TO C# CONVERTER WARNING: Method 'throws' clauses are not available in C#:
//ORIGINAL LINE: public void write(org.codehaus.jackson.JsonGenerator out, Iterable<String> columns, org.neo4j.graphdb.Result_ResultRow row, TransactionStateChecker txStateChecker) throws java.io.IOException
        public override void Write(JsonGenerator @out, IEnumerable <string> columns, Org.Neo4j.Graphdb.Result_ResultRow row, TransactionStateChecker txStateChecker)
        {
            @out.writeArrayFieldStart("row");
            try
            {
                foreach (string key in columns)
                {
                    @out.writeObject(row.Get(key));
                }
            }
            finally
            {
                @out.writeEndArray();
                WriteMeta(@out, columns, row);
            }
        }